What is a Servitization Mentor?
As a mentor for two of our partners, I am the focal point for anyone within their respective organisations who want to know, understand or use any of our tools, frameworks, or just better understand how advanced services can help them, and their customers, become more successful.
What do you bring to the role?
My 12+ years at ASG have equipped me with deep expertise in business model innovation, gained from working with a diverse range of 250+ manufacturing businesses. By guiding partners through the Servitization Playbook, I can accelerate their transformation process.
How do you support your partners?
I am responsible for sharing the IP from ASG research with my partners. I ensure that these tools and models are utilised to their full potential. By doing so, I serve as a bridge to help my partners make a positive impact in their processing equipment and the energy industry.
I meet them regularly, build coalitions within my partners and support them when they join us at our three Roundtable meetings per year.

Top Tip for Manufacturers
Try and break convention and forget about selling products – circular economy, net zero and sustainability drivers mean moving into advanced services at some point. It’s only a matter of time before Servitization and Advanced Services become part of your strategy – best to start now!
